    Meet Glutathione: Your Body’s Cellular Shield

    Think of glutathione as a tiny but tireless guardian inside your cells. Built from three amino acids— glycine, cysteine, and glutamate — it patrols where aging really begins: deep in your DNA and mitochondria [5].

    That’s why scientistscall it the “master antioxidant.” Unlike other antioxidants that work inspecific areas, glutathione sits at the center of your body’s defense system.It shields DNA from oxidative damage, keeps your energy engines (mitochondria)running, and helps recycle vitamin C and E so they can continue protecting yourcells. In the process, glutathione also guards collagen — the very protein thatkeeps skin smooth and firm. With enough glutathione on duty, your body staysmore resilient, even as stress and years add up.

    Glutathione works quietly behind the scenes, but it touches nearly every process linked withvisible aging [6]:

    • Neutralizing free radicals: Without enough glutathione, free radicals damage DNA and breakdown collagen — leading to earlier fine lines.
    • Recycling other antioxidants: Vitamins C and E rely on glutathione to stay active. Without it, your skin’s natural glow fades more quickly.
    • Supporting detoxification and hormones: The liver depends on glutathione to process toxinsand hormones. Low levels mean slower clearance and more inflammation [7].
    • Protecting mitochondria: Your cell “batteries” need glutathione for energy. When levels drop, fatigue rises, and skin looks dull.

    The challenge? Glutathione levels decline naturally with age — and more steeply in women underchronic stress, poor sleep, alcohol, or hormonal changes [8].

    The Glutathione Decline: What Really Happens With Age

    If you think of glutathione as your body’s inner shield, aging can be seen as the slow softening of that shield’s strength.

    Research shows that glutathione levels naturally decline as the years pass [14,15]. In young adulthood, this defense system is abundant and flexible — oxidative stress is quickly neutralized, DNA damage is repaired, and mitochondria stay charged. But with time, the supply line weakens.

    • In your 20s: Glutathione is plentiful. Your skin bounces back from sun exposure, late nights, or stresswith barely a trace.
    • By your 30s: Levels begin to dip. Fine lines, dullness, or slower recovery after stress may be the first whispers of change.
    • Through your 40s and 50s: The decline becomes sharper. Studies suggest that by the 60s, glutathione may be reduced by up to 50% compared with younger levels [15].
    • Beyond 60: The imbalance between free radicals and antioxidant defenses tilts more heavily toward oxidative stress, fueling wrinkles, fatigue, and greater vulnerability to age-related conditions.

    Natural Ways to Support Glutathione (Vegetarian Focus)

    The encouraging part? Your body already knows how to make glutathione — it just needs the right raw materials and conditions to do the job well.

    That starts with your lifestyle. Deep, restorative sleep, regular movement, and limiting alcohol are proven ways to help your antioxidant system recharge [12]. Even moderate exercise has been shown to support glutathione metabolism.

    Nutrition plays an equally powerful role. Sulfur-rich vegetables like broccoli, Brussels sprouts,garlic, and onions provide key building blocks. Add vitamin C-rich fruits and peppers, and selenium from Brazil nuts or mushrooms, and you’re supplying the cofactors that keep glutathione levels steady [13].

    Sometimes food alone may not be enough - especially when stress, age, or hormonal changes demand more antioxidant power. That’s where certain precursor nutrients step in. Think of them as the raw materials your body needs to keep producing glutathione. You can find them in a vegetarian diet, but in amounts that may not always be sufficient for therapeutic effects.

    • Cysteine (via NAC): NAC is often taken as a supplement, but foods like lentils, oats, sunflower seeds, and garlic can provide natural support.
    • Glycine: This calming amino acid is found in soy products,spinach, kale, pumpkin seeds, and sesame seeds - all helpful when stress drains your body’s reserves.
    • Alpha-lipoicacid (ALA): Present in small amounts in spinach, broccoli, tomatoes, peas, and Brussels sprouts, ALA helps recycle other antioxidants and keep glutathione active [14].

    These foods lay the foundation for your body’s defenses. But research shows that when it comes to therapeutic effects - like anti-aging, skin-brightening, or perimenopause resilience - diet alone is usually not enough. That’s why most clinical studies rely on supplements of NAC, glycine, or ALA to achieve measurable results [13,15,21].
